For 1/8"- 2" Pipe Sizes
Style G
Ideal for monitoring air compressor outputs, pneumatic tool consumption and industrial gas flows.
CHOICE OF THREE MATERIALS OF CONSTRUCTION
Select from aluminum, brass or stainless steel to meet system and media compatibility requirements.
UNRESTRICTED MOUNTING
Allows the designer to install the meter in any orientation – horizontal, vertical or inverted.
SUPERIOR EXTERIOR DESIGN
Weather-tight for use outdoors and/or on systems where wash downs are required.
RUGGED AND RELIABLE
These meters are constructed with all metal pressure vessels, allowing safe, permanent installation in industrial systems.
HIGH PRESSURE OPERATION
The magnetically coupled follower and rigid pressure vessel design allows operation to 1000 PSIG.
24 DIFFERENT PORTS AVAILABLE
Standard selection of NPT, SAE and BSP ports reduces the amount of adapters required for installation.
LOW COST ACCURACY
±2.5% of range accuracy in center third of scale; ±4% in upper and lower thirds.
Engineering Specification
THE PNEUMATIC IN-LINE FLOW METER SHALL:
- Use the variable annular orifice technique with compression spring recoil.
- Not require inlet or outlet straight plumbing, or require vertical pipe mounting.
- Have a measuring accuracy of ±2.5% of full scale in the center third of the measuring range, and ±4% in upper and lower thirds.
- Have a stainless steel sharp-edged orifice.
- Have a weather-tight external construction.

| Performance |
Measuring accuracy: |
±2.5% of full-scale in the center third of the measuring range; ±4% in upper and lower thirds |
Repeatability: |
±1% of full-scale |
Flow measuring range: |
1.5-1300 SCFM @ 100 PSIG (1-610 LPS) |
Pressure differential: |
Click here for specific pressure differential graphs |
Maximum operating pressure: |
aluminum and brass meters: 600 PSIG (40 Bar)
stainless steel meters: 1000 PSIG (70 Bar) |
Maximum operating temperature: |
240°F (116°C) Note: for operation to 600°F (316°C), click here |
Standard calibration fluids: |
Air @ 70°F (21°C), 1.0 sg and 100 PSIG (6.8 Bar) |
Filtration requirements: |
74 micron filter or 200 mesh screen minimum |
